Output bb830664187f704934662b30ce0eb824d9bf40e8d0d54f7340d0232b34d6231a:17

value
87451866
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dcbe02d5609f4d41465012a837812e82f75e60f2 OP_EQUALVERIFY OP_CHECKSIG
address
1M8BHQPH14z2X2mRFYvxyqeKsPkHb5dt7q
transaction
bb830664187f704934662b30ce0eb824d9bf40e8d0d54f7340d0232b34d6231a
spent
true